THE CALCULATION OF A CENTRIFUGAL COMPRESSOR IN THE FLOWVISION SOFTWARE PACKAGE

Abstract

The article discusses the method of calculating the centrifugal compressor of a diesel engine in the FlowVision software package. The features of loading the model for solving the problem in the sector-sliding formulation are considered. The features of the calculation are given, such as: installation of a throttle valve with a variable angle of inclination at the outlet, limiting parameters, an adaptive computational grid. The visualization of the main parameters of the compressor in volume and in sections is presented. The test of a centrifugal compressor on a stand with different angular velocities and at different air flow rates is simulated. Based on the test results, graphs of the compressor characteristics were compiled and compared with the experimental characteristics of the prototypes TKR 700.1-01 and K27-54.3-01. The results showed good convergence, which allows us to conclude that the model was built correctly and that it can be used for similar calculations.
